Thea Energy is commercializing fusion energy using stellarator physics breakthroughs. This Manager role owns strategic sourcing and technical subcontracts for custom-built fusion components including cryogenic systems and vacuum vessels.
Key responsibilities include drafting, negotiating, and executing significant technical subcontracts with suppliers. You will manage supplier performance against complex statements of work, tracking milestones, costs, and technical quality. You'll formulate negotiation strategies covering intellectual property protection, confidentiality, liability, risk distribution, and long-term pricing—ensuring all vendor agreements appropriately manage financial, operational, and legal risk.
The role bridges engineering needs with business agreements, translating technical requirements and program milestones into contractual terms, acceptance criteria, and payment schedules. You'll source and evaluate vendor capabilities globally to build an active pipeline of advanced manufacturing partners, and own non-disclosure and confidentiality agreements supporting supplier and partner engagement.
Ideal candidates bring 6+ years managing subcontracts, complex supplier agreements, or commercial procurement contracts. Background in hard-tech, aerospace, defense, or heavy industrial energy projects is highly valued. Deep knowledge of contract law—warranties, IP protections, termination, liability limitations—is essential. Strong attention to detail in contract drafting and document control, negotiation and relationship skills for high-stakes agreements, and cross-functional leadership ability to coordinate inputs from engineering, finance, and legal teams are critical.
